Meet the captains of winter athletics: Natalie Maloney

As Palo Alto High School’s winter sports teams build chemistry and prepare for league play with vigor, the new captains of the soccer, wrestling and basketball teams enter the scene ready to take on the field, the floor and the court. Let’s meet the captains.

Girls’ Soccer 

The girl’s varsity soccer team  once again shown its excellence on the field with a stunning 11-0 victory over El Camino High School (0-6, 0-0) on Thursday, and is currently on a five-game undefeated streak in its preseason matches.

Senior captain Natalie Maloney shares a laugh with The Paly Voice as she recalls a handshake between her and a fellow teammate. Photo: Bianca Al-Shamari.

Meet Natalie Maloney. Senior Maloney has been playing for varsity since her freshman year.

NM: “I started playing soccer when I was 6 years old because my brother started playing and I wanted in on the action. Right before pre-season games started, my coach called me and told me that I was going to be captain for the 2016-17 season. It’s such a huge honor because the Paly program has seen some amazing players pass through and this current team is incredible, so it’s crazy to be a leader of such an insanely talented group of girls.”

PV: What are you looking forward to most this season?

NM: “I’m definitely looking forward to playing our rivals, Mountian View. That’s a game that everyone should come see. It’s going to be a tough match.”
